Web Registration: Fees, Suffixes, and Safety

Securing your online brand begins with internet registration. The price for a domain name can vary significantly, typically starting around $ 12 per year, but escalating with desirable extensions or advanced services. Popular suffixes like .com, .net, and .org are frequently selected, but newer options like .tech, .online, or country-specific choices may provide a distinctive appeal. Above all, domain security is paramount; consider enabling WHOIS privacy, utilizing strong passwords, and regularly checking your account settings to safeguard your web asset.

Domain Registration vs. Internet Server Space: What's Variation

Many newcomers get confused about registering a web address and online hosting . Think of it like this: your domain name is your site's address – it's what people type into their search bar to find you. Domain registration simply provides you the right to use that specific address. However, you need a space to actually store your online content. That’s where server space comes in. It’s the lease of server space on an internet server that makes your site accessible to the online audience.

Essentially:

  • Domain Registration = Your location
  • Online hosting = Your land

You need both to have a fully functional website .
